Why You Should Choose a Double leeds glazing Repair Service Double-glazed windows help reduce your heating bills. They can cause mist when air enters the space between the windows. This is usually the result of an unsound seal. A window repair company can fix the issue for you. Coral Windows is a Yorkshire-based business that specializes in upvc window hinge...